2004 BMW 325 vs. 2011 Lexus LFA

To start off, 2011 Lexus LFA is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 BMW 325.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 BMW 325 would be higher. At 4,805 cc (10 cylinders), 2011 Lexus LFA is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Lexus LFA (552 HP @ 8700 RPM) has 368 more horse power than 2004 BMW 325. (184 HP @ 7250 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Lexus LFA should accelerate faster than 2004 BMW 325.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 BMW 325 weights approximately 115 kg more than 2011 Lexus LFA.

Let's talk about torque, 2011 Lexus LFA (480 Nm) has 243 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 BMW 325. (237 Nm). This means 2011 Lexus LFA will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 BMW 325.
